How these figures are counted

Enterprises are counted by their primary NACE; establishment units are not counted. Counted in the KBO's NACE 2025 nomenclature, the one in which code 29100 exists.

Bankruptcies and the failure rate are attributed by each company's current primary NACE, not the NACE at the time of bankruptcy (which the gazette does not record).

The comparison with the country and with the other NACE divisions comes from a nightly overview of every division, each counted in the nomenclature in which it exists. A standing such as "higher than 80%" counts the other divisions that have the figure. The bankruptcy probability is the median of our nightly score over the division's companies that have one; the count is stated.

The key figures cover the whole NACE division 29, not NACE 29100 on its own: there are too few filed annual accounts per five-digit code to compute them separately. Medians over NBB annual accounts, all schema types combined.
